if you do it yourslef around 400-600 bucks for head alone (im in canada so may be cheaper down in the usa) since all you need is the gasket set and a machine shop to plane the head. if the head need anymore work than a resurface it can get pricey. normally the block doest need the resurface as cast is alot harder to warp than aluminum. just clean it really well
